Imran Series (Mazhar Kaleem) - Characters Created By Mazhar Kaleem

Characters Created By Mazhar Kaleem

Mazhar Kaleem acquired fame through writing about Ibn-e-Safi's famous character in the Imran Series in the late 1960s. After Ibn-e-Safi many writers tried to write within the Imran series but few have lasted beyond a few novels except Kaleem. He has now written over five hundred novels. He has brought many new characters to the Imran Series and introduced various new topics like mystic crimes (Misaale Dunya) and economic crimes (Kaghazee Qiyamat). Imran Series has a range of diverse, colorful, and sentient characters. Few Character created by Kaleem are as below:-

  • Captain Shakeel
  • Tiger
  • Juanna
  • Col.David
  • Madaam Rekha
  • Faisal Jaan
